Fighting Flowers
The sun shines sweetly, blessing the field with rays
The one thing that’s sure, it will rise every day
The field below is scattered, chaos amongst ordinary light
Oh why does everyone have to get up and fight?
We all stand guarded under the vast blue sky
We wake up in the morning and go to sleep to a lullaby
So why do we wake
And carelessly throw words we make
I don’t want to stand out like a weed in wildflowers
A weed who thinks what it’s doing is right
But eventually discovers
It’s better just to not care and fight
To fight with another, punch out the feelings
A free for all fight, but none of us are healing
Perhaps eventually we will change
And be united as one, under the sunrays
